Although the strips of floral cake frosting in the photo were horizontal, I placed my floral strips vertically. I stamped white cardstock strips with various stamps and mounted the strips on a black panel. I adhered a sparkly ribbon around the panel. The die cut flower and leaf images as well as the sentiment panel were cut with the Pierced Blooms dies.
